网页设计已经成为一门充满创意和挑战的艺术。在众多网页元素中,弹窗(Popup)以其独特的功能性和美观性,成为了设计师们争相运用的重要元素。本文将深入剖析弹窗CSS代码的艺术,探讨其设计原理、应用技巧以及未来发展趋势。

一、弹窗CSS代码的设计原理

弹窗CSS代码的艺术现代网页设计的魅力  第1张

1. 结构化布局

弹窗CSS代码的设计,首先需要遵循结构化布局的原则。一个优秀的弹窗,应该具备清晰的层次结构和易于识别的元素。通过合理地运用CSS盒模型、浮动、定位等属性,可以使弹窗布局更加紧凑、美观。

2. 适应性设计

在移动端和PC端,弹窗的显示效果可能存在差异。因此,弹窗CSS代码需要具备良好的适应性。通过使用媒体查询(Media Queries)等技术,可以实现对不同屏幕尺寸的弹窗进行优化,确保用户在各个设备上都能获得良好的使用体验。

3. 交互性设计

弹窗的交互性是提升用户体验的关键。通过运用CSS动画、过渡效果等,可以使弹窗在打开、关闭、切换等操作中,呈现出流畅、自然的视觉效果。合理地设置弹窗的交互逻辑,如点击关闭按钮、拖动弹窗等,可以增强用户的参与感。

4. 颜色搭配与字体选择

弹窗的视觉效果很大程度上取决于颜色搭配和字体选择。设计师应遵循色彩心理学,选择与网站主题相协调的颜色,使弹窗在视觉上更加和谐。根据弹窗内容的特点,选择合适的字体,确保用户能够轻松阅读。

二、弹窗CSS代码的应用技巧

1. 精简代码

在编写弹窗CSS代码时,应尽量精简代码,避免冗余。通过合并同类选择器、删除不必要的属性等手段,可以提高代码的可读性和可维护性。

2. 利用CSS预处理器

CSS预处理器如Sass、Less等,可以帮助设计师编写更加简洁、高效的代码。通过使用变量、混合(Mixins)、函数等特性,可以简化弹窗CSS代码的编写过程。

3. 引用权威资料

在设计弹窗CSS代码时,可以参考一些权威的资料,如《CSS权威指南》、《响应式Web设计》等。这些资料提供了丰富的设计理念和实践经验,有助于提升弹窗的视觉效果。

三、弹窗CSS代码的未来发展趋势

1. 动态效果与交互性

随着前端技术的发展,弹窗的动态效果和交互性将得到进一步提升。未来,设计师可以利用CSS动画、JavaScript等技术,实现更加丰富的弹窗效果。

2. 个性化定制

随着用户需求的多样化,弹窗的个性化定制将成为趋势。设计师可以根据用户的行为习惯、喜好等因素,为用户提供个性化的弹窗体验。

3. 跨平台适配

随着移动端设备的普及,弹窗的跨平台适配将成为重要课题。设计师需要关注不同操作系统、浏览器之间的兼容性问题,确保弹窗在各个平台上都能正常显示。

弹窗CSS代码的艺术,是现代网页设计的重要组成部分。通过深入了解弹窗的设计原理、应用技巧以及未来发展趋势,设计师可以创造出更加美观、实用的弹窗效果,为用户提供更好的使用体验。在未来的网页设计中,弹窗CSS代码将继续发挥重要作用,为互联网世界增添更多精彩。